Bombay, Baroda and Central India Railway
The Bombay, Baroda and Central India Railway (BBCIR) was incorporated in 1855 for the construction and working of a line from Bombay, via Surat and Baroda, to Ahmedabad. The distance in total is around 320 miles including stations at Bombay, Grant Road, Marine Lines, Church Gate and Kolaba.
